Here’s something from the great Quincy Jones in 1962 off of his Mercury Lp entitled Big Band Bossa Nova, and “Soul Bossa Nova”. You may remember this from Austin Powers, but Hip Hop heads will remember it from the North of the Border jazz influenced band Dream Warriors, who sampled Quincy for “My Definition of A Boombastic Jazz Style”.
